Earliest Supermassive Black Holes Were The early Universe is a puzzling and--in many ways--still-unknown place. The first billion years of cosmic history saw the explosive creation of stars and the growth of the first galaxies. It’s also a time when the earliest known black holes appeared to grow very massive quickly. Astronomers want to know how they grew and why …
